The Definition of Growing Pains

Growing pain can vary in each individual, but typically occurs mostly in children and growing teenagers, or adolescents. Most growing pains occur between the ages of 3 and 12, and can affect the legs, muscles, bones, and other rapidly-growing areas of the body. Growing pains are often linked to:

  • Imbalances and Tightness: Muscle imbalances and tightness can lead to increased discomfort, especially while playing sports.
  • Physical Activity: Increasing physical activity may lead to overuse of muscles, also known as muscle fatigue, enhancing the sensation of already existing growing pains.
  • Rapid Growth Spurts: In some children and teens, rapid growth spurts are more common and obvious, causing rapid physical change in a short period.

Common Symptoms of Growing Pains

Common signs and symptoms of natural growing pains in children and teens include:

  • Muscle aches and pains that typically occur in the legs
  • Pain that can be alleviated with heat application, stretching, or massage
  • Short-lived discomfort or intermittent discomfort
  • The pain increases in the evening or throughout the night
